§ 15 §1103 — Summary contempt proceeding involving a punitive sanction

Maine·Title 15 COURT PROCEDURE -- CRIMINAL·Part 2 PROCEEDINGS BEFORE TRIAL·Ch. 105-A MAINE BAIL CODE
The setting of bail for an alleged contemnor in a summary contempt proceeding involving a punitive sanction under the Maine Rules of Civil Procedure, Rule 66, including any appeal under section 2115‑B, is a matter wholly within the discretion of the court. Subchapters 4 and 5 apply.
